Relationship between race time and number of accurate shots of the five best biathletes in the 2009/10 world cup in the 10 km race

(Zusammenhang zwischen Wettkampfzeit und Trefferzahl der fünf besten Biathleten über 10 km im Weltcup 2009/2010)

INTRODUCTION: Knowing how to combine fitness with the ability to concentrate and shoot accurately in the firing zone are determinant factors for performance in Biathlon (Sattlecker et al., 2007, 2009). This statistical study analyzes the time and results of the five best biathletes in the different competitions of 2009/10 World Cup classified in the 10 km race. METHOD: A Line of basic statistical analysis was applied to the IBU 2010 official data, focusing on estimating average times with confidence intervals, the percentage of precision in the firing zone and the relationship between skiing time and errors using the regression method linear. RESULTS: Based on the slope of the regression statistics obtained in each case, b (-0,0044:0,1371), the results indicate a slight but clear trend for the number of failures to decrease (from 0, 0044 and 0.0413 failures) as the skiing time of these five skiers is greater. DISCUSSION: According to our analysis, fatigue affects performance in biathlon shooting (Huysmans et al., 2006). We agree with Mognoni et al. (2001), that high values of VO2max (> 65 ml min kg-1) and resting heart values close to 50 bpm. are essential for success in the shot (Coote, 2009). Other factors that affect performance are mental training and relaxation techniques (Groslambert et al. 2003). CONCLUSION: The data provided show the importance of precision in the shot biathlete performance. Technical preparation (precision in shooting) is more important than physical preparation to obtain results.
